John Eastman disbarred: The California Supreme Court has officially disbarred John Eastman, a former attorney for President Donald Trump, marking a significant moment in the ongoing discourse surrounding legal ethics and political accountability. Eastman’s disbarment stems from his role in efforts to overturn the results of the 2020 presidential election, a move that many legal experts have condemned as a direct threat to the integrity of the electoral process.

Legal Misconduct and Professional Standards
Eastman was not disbarred for merely expressing a political opinion but for what the California State Bar Court identified as “egregious and deceitful conduct.” His plan to have then-Vice President Mike Pence reject electoral votes was deemed an act that undermined the rule of law. This ruling emphasizes that attorneys must adhere to ethical standards, regardless of the political climate or client pressures.
This case illustrates the precarious nature of legal advocacy, especially when it intersects with partisan politics. Eastman’s defense, which claims that his disbarment raises serious constitutional concerns, has not gained traction. The court’s decision underscores that the First Amendment does not grant a blanket license for attorneys to engage in unethical behavior.
